site stats

Python verhoeff's dihedral group d5 check

Webb4= cross (b1, b2); b5= cross (b2, b4); Dihedral= atan2 (dot (b3, b4), dot (b3, b5) * sqrt (dot (b2, b2))); Similar to your dihedral2. 12 adds, 21 multiplies, 1 square root, 1 arctangent. … WebWrite down the Cayley table of the dihedral group D5 = {1, r, r2, r3, r4, s, sr, sr2, sr3, sr4}. Then use your Cayley table to find the inverse of each element in this group. 3. Find the order of each element of the group of units modulo 24, U (24). Hence or otherwise, determine whether or not this group is cyclic. 4.

Verhoeff algorithm - Wikipedia

http://www.augustana.ualberta.ca/~mohrj/algorithms/checkdigit.html WebThe Python divisible program that tests whether a number is divisible by another number, that is, gives the result zero when the modulus or remainder (%) operator is applied is … security boundary or network firewall https://loudandflashy.com

The dihedral groups - Northeastern University

WebNov 27, 2006 · Unlike previously exmamined methods (which operate over Z ), Verhoeff's Algorithm operates over the dihedral group D5. The algorithm is in use by companies such as ESB Networks of the Republic of Ireland. The algorithm is perfect in that it detects all Single Errors and all Transposition Errors. WebDec 21, 2013 · Credit Card Check Digits ISBN Check Digits Verhoeff’s Dihedral Group D5 Check Concluding Activities Exercises Connections Games: NIM and the 15 Puzzle The Game of NIM The 15 Puzzle Concluding Activities Exercises Connections Finite Fields, the Group of Units in Zn, and Splitting Fields Introduction Finite Fields The Group of Units of a … WebMay 28, 2024 · In addition to the class above, I also decided to take a shot at some unit tests for the algorithm using pytest. import string import itertools import pytest from check_sums import Verhoeff # modification and utility functions to test the check digit algorihm robustness DIGIT_REPLACEMENTS = { digit: string.digits.replace (digit, "") for digit ... security boxes fireproof amazon

Program to find number divisible by 3 or 5 in python

Category:Verhoeffs Dihedral Check MrExcel Message Board

Tags:Python verhoeff's dihedral group d5 check

Python verhoeff's dihedral group d5 check

6.4.2 Check-digit Computation - Release File Specification …

WebVerhoeff proposed a scheme which avoids the weakness of the preceding three schemes in failing to detect some adjacent transpositions due to using addition modulo 10. His … WebOct 14, 2024 · The group presentation of a dihedral group D n is. r, s: r n = 1, s 2 = 1, s r = r − 1 s . Since D n is generated by r and s, every element will be of the form. r α 1 s β 1 … r α k s β k. where 0 ≤ α i < n, 0 ≤ β i < 2 and k ≥ 1. Since we can always swap the position of s and r by using the relation s r = r − 1 s, we can ...

Python verhoeff's dihedral group d5 check

Did you know?

WebSep 7, 2024 · Theorem 5.21. The group D n, n ≥ 3, consists of all products of the two elements r and s, satisfying the relations. r n = 1 s 2 = 1 s r s = r − 1. Proof. This page titled 5.2: Dihedral Groups is shared under a GNU Free Documentation License 1.3 license and was authored, remixed, and/or curated by Thomas W. Judson ( Abstract Algebra: Theory ... Web2, group actions 1.Write an explicit embedding of the dihedral group D n into the symmetric group S n. Solution Let us consider a regular n-gon in the plane R2 whose center is the origin and having the point (1;0) as a vertex. The subgroup of M 2 consisting of the isometries of the plane that preserve is a dihedral group D n, generated by the ...

WebApr 16, 2024 · Dihedral groups are those groups that describe both rotational and reflectional symmetry of regular n -gons. Definition: Dihedral Group For n ≥ 3, the dihedral group Dn is defined to be the group consisting of the symmetry actions of a regular n -gon, where the operation is composition of actions. WebNov 25, 2024 · >> CHECK OUT THE COURSE. 1. Introduction. In this tutorial, we'll cover some of the basics of testing a concurrent program. We'll primarily focus on thread-based …

WebNov 11, 2024 · November 11, 2024 / Sandipan Dey. The following problems appeared as assignments in the edX course Analytics for Computing (by Gatech ). The descriptions are … WebJacobus figured out that he could use the operation of what's known as the 'dihedral group D5', which derives from the symmetries of a pentagon, and can be represented as the … Easily build, package, release, update, and deploy your project in any language—on … Trusted by millions of developers. We protect and defend the most trustworthy … Filter, sort, group, and assign issues. Your hands never leave the keyboard. Extend …

WebThe Verhoeff algorithm can be implemented using three tables: Multiplication table d. The first table, d, is based on multiplication in the dihedral groupD5. Note that this group is not …

WebIt * was the first decimal check digit algorithm which detects all single-digit * errors, and all transposition errors involving two adjacent digits. ... * Verhoeff algorithm purple tulle wedding dressWebJul 20, 2024 · Verhoeff's Dihedral check is used as the algorithm for validating India's Aadhaar unique identification numbers. I'm pleased to tell you (a little late, I know!) that … security bpsshttp://www.augustana.ualberta.ca/~mohrj/algorithms/checkdigit.html purple turtle products wareham maWebMay 20, 2024 · Step #1: We’ll label the rows and columns with the elements of Z 5, in the same order from left to right and top to bottom. Step #2: We’ll fill in the table. Each entry is the result of adding the row label to the column label, then reducing mod 5. Features of … security boys meyertonWebMar 24, 2024 · The group D_5 is one of the two groups of order 10. Unlike the cyclic group C_(10), D_5 is non-Abelian. The molecule ruthenocene (C_5H_5)_2Ru belongs to the group … security braceletWebQuestion: (a) Consider the symmetry group of the pentagon, which we called the dihedral group D5. Is D5 abelian? Justify your answer. (b) Using the notation in example 6 in lecture 12, prove that D5 =< τ, σ2 > (a) Consider the symmetry group of the pentagon, which we called the dihedral group D5. Is D5 abelian? Justify your answer. purple turtle for shelvesWebin the group D n: Rotations R 0;R 1;:::;R n 1, where R k is rotation of angle 2ˇk=n. Re ections S 0;S 1;:::;S n 1, where S k is re ection about the line through the origin and making an angle of ˇk=nwith the horizontal axis. The group operation is given by composition of symmetries: if aand bare two elements in D n, then a b= b a. That is to ... security box for camera dvr